摘要: 原文:http://www.tomytime.com/archives/218/ fflush()函数是标准的作法。 setbuf(stdin,NULL)是GCC下可用的一种方法。 scanf("%*[^\n]%*c")是用扫描集将缓冲区中的字符全部读取来实现清除缓冲区的动作。 我最近在ubuntu下写一个程序,涉及到了这方面的问题。用fflush()和setbuf(stdin,NULL)... 阅读全文
posted @ 2013-12-01 23:24 小菜庞 阅读(790) 评论(0) 推荐(0) 编辑